CVE-2026-9504
GNU LibreDWG Dwggrep Utility dwggrep.c bit_convert_TU out-of-bounds
Description

A weakness has been identified in GNU LibreDWG up to 0.14. Affected is the function bit_convert_TU of the file programs/dwggrep.c of the component Dwggrep Utility. This manipulation causes out-of-bounds read. The attack needs to be launched locally. The exploit has been made available to the public and could be used for attacks. Patch name: be996bf2178a40e98720f18c2414815d244413db. Applying a patch is the recommended action to fix this issue.
